[Boot/Shutdown] 系统睡眠后唤醒黑屏 V23
Tofloor
poster avatar
想用deepin玩游戏
deepin
2023-05-29 04:06
Author

系统待机睡眠后,按电源键,屏幕由熄屏变成微微亮,电脑风扇狂转,一直无法点亮屏幕。

 

 

 

Reply Favorite View the author
All Replies
阿尼樱奈奈
deepin
2023-05-29 04:08
#1

这睡眠是已经存在的问题,部分机器上会出现这个情况。

Reply View the author
WangZhongyun
deepin
2023-05-29 04:14
#2

如果要系统睡眠醒来顺利的话,需要设置足够的虚拟内存。

Reply View the author
想用deepin玩游戏
deepin
2023-05-29 04:29
#3
WangZhongyun

如果要系统睡眠醒来顺利的话,需要设置足够的虚拟内存。

电脑32G内存,还要设置虚拟内存,过分了

Reply View the author
WangZhongyun
deepin
2023-05-29 04:42
#4
想用deepin玩游戏

电脑32G内存,还要设置虚拟内存,过分了

内存再大也是断电就没有了,只有内存不断电的才行

Reply View the author
Mr-Wan
deepin
2023-05-29 04:51
#5
想用deepin玩游戏

电脑32G内存,还要设置虚拟内存,过分了

睡眠是隔很复杂的东西。在acpi标准里大概就叫s0 到  s5。一般所说的睡眠在系统里有3各类别,suspend to ram ,suspend to disk ,和 Hybrid sleep。suspend to disk 和 hubrid sleep 就是需要把内存内容存到硬盘里,在硬盘里的位置就是 swap 。你没有swap,让系统把内存数据放哪去。

当前linux支持创建一个文件作为swap使用,是不是可以支持睡眠,个人并不清楚,没试过。

正常来说还是需要有swap的,不单纯是内存够不够的问题,虽然不清楚当前情况,以前linux在内存的调度分配时是需要swap空间的,否则会影响内存的性能,类似你整理堆满东西的桌子,旁边最好有个空架子让你用的,整理起来更快更方便。

Reply View the author
hyjiao
deepin
2023-05-29 05:39
#6

休眠需要swap足够大,物理内存大应该是没有用的。休眠和待机不一样的。休眠时会先把当前状态保存到swap(交换区和windows中的虚拟内存差不多)中,然后再执行关机。swap是硬盘中的区域,断电后内容可以保存,而物理内存断电后是不能保存的。休眠时物理内存应该是断电状态的。唤醒的时候其实和开机流程是一样的,只是进入桌面后会把休眠前保存的状态恢复一下。Deepin中的待机和windows中的睡眠一样。待机内存是不断电的,不能完全关闭电源。

Reply View the author
catubibu
deepin
2023-05-29 20:15
#7

32G RAM, 16G SWAP, 睡眠很好,蓝牙音响的网易音乐每次都能自动开播。

截图_选择区域_20230529121334.png

Reply View the author
wcs4221
deepin
2023-05-29 20:48
#8

23b可以试用。切在不断好用中!

Reply View the author
暮成雪
deepin
2023-09-30 16:08
#9
Reply View the author